Crop strength through diversity

Article Abstract:

New research shows that rice blast, the main disease of rice, can be controlled by growing mixtures of rice varieties. This approach reverses the trend towards monoculture that is increasingly adopted by the world's food growers.

ABC of meningococcal diversity

Article Abstract:

The entire genome sequences of the Neisseria meningitidis serogroup A and B organisms have been reported. This represents a milestone in meningococcal research.
